The classic winter sun destinations
Cape Town, South Africa — the great escape
January in Cape Town averages a glorious 26°C, with the Atlantic sparkling around the city. The winelands, Table Mountain and the beaches of the Cape Peninsula give you more than just sunbathing. The Canary Islands — the evergreen choice
With 21-22°C averages year-round, the Canaries are the closest warm escape to Europe. Fuerteventura and Lanzarote offer quieter beaches than Tenerife and Gran Canaria, and the smaller islands keep their local character. December-January is still pleasant — and half the price of July.
Morocco — the Atlantic coast
Essaouira, Agadir and the fishing towns of the Atlantic coast combine 20°C temperatures, strong surf and the maze of medinas. Cape Verde — the Caribbean of Africa
With temperatures above 25°C all winter, the Cape Verde islands are the ultimate warm escape from Europe’s cold. Sal and Boa Vista offer white-sand beaches and Atlantic surf, while the islands of Santiago and Santo Antão deliver mountain hiking and local culture. Djerba, Tunisia — the Mediterranean winter
Djerba enjoys mild 18-20°C winter days with real Mediterranean charm — whitewashed villages, markets and a relaxed pace. Our Djerba guide and the Festival Ulysse coverage show why the island is rediscovering itself as a cultural winter destination.
The value destinations for winter 2026-27
| Destination | January temp | Week budget (flights + hotel) | Best for |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cape Town | 26°C | €900-1,800 | Active travelers |
| Canary Islands | 21°C | €550-1,200 | Easy week away |
| Morocco coast | 20°C | €450-950 | Culture + surf |
| Cape Verde | 25°C | €650-1,400 | Beach + hiking |
| Djerba | 19°C | €450-900 | Quiet charm |

When to book winter sun 2026-27
- August-September — book flights for December and February; prices rise sharply after September.
- October — the best hotels for the festive weeks and half-term are almost gone.
- November-January — the value window. January is the cheapest month of the winter season.
- December-February — travel. Expect higher prices on Christmas and half-term weeks only.

How to avoid the crowds
- Choose the smaller island. Fuerteventura over Tenerife, Boa Vista over Sal, La Gomera over Gran Canaria.
- Travel in January. The festive weeks are the crowded ones; January brings the same sun with half the people.
- Pick coastal towns over resorts. Agadir’s quieter neighbours and Cape Town’s suburbs keep the local pace.
- Go slightly off the coast. Inland villages and winelands give you the same sun with better prices.
